Batam has been designed as an industrial city since its inception in 1970, and continues to strive to increase Batam's economy from various industrial sectors. As an industrial city, Batam has around 1,309 superior industries, both foreign direct investment (FDI) and domestic investment (PMDN) with a total of 169,000 workers from oil and gas, and non-oil and gas production.

The leading industry categories for foreign investors in Batam include:

Industry
Company
Metals and Machinery
109
Leather, Rubber, Plastics, and Packaging
85
Electronics and Electricals
77
Shipping and Support
66
Oil and Gas and Support
39

In line with the rapid population growth, BP Batam views business opportunities in the domestic investment sector as a leading industry to build and improve small and medium enterprises (SMEs). The types of domestic investment industries that have become a priority for leading industries are:

Industry
Company
Transportation Services
184
Construction Industry Services
106
Metal and Machinery Industries
85
Industrial Services
85
Shipping and Support Industry
72

Through the implementation of leading industry priorities, industrial activities are expected to result in a wide double effect for increasing the added value of domestic raw materials, absorption of local labor, and foreign exchange earnings from exports.
